Seafood Restaurants in Rhode Island
When Guy Fieri’s red Camaro rolled into the Ocean State, he discovered that Rhode Island’s compact size packs a serious seafood punch. Between 2007 and 2015, the Diners, Drive-Ins and Dives crew visited four standout seafood spots scattered from Providence to the coastal towns, finding an average rating of 4.4 stars across these flavorful destinations.
Leading the pack is Louis Restaurant in Providence, earning an impressive 4.9-star rating with dishes that had Guy reaching for seconds. Down in Middletown, Anthony’s Seafood (4.5★) proved that fresh-off-the-boat fare and no-frills atmosphere create pure magic. And at Evelyn’s Drive-In in Tiverton, the waterside setting and classic preparations showcase everything that makes Rhode Island a seafood lover’s paradise.
While two of these original four spots have since closed their doors, the remaining restaurants continue serving up the kind of bold, authentic flavors that earned them a spot on Triple D. From stuffed quahogs to crispy calamari, these Rhode Island gems prove that some of the best seafood in America comes from the smallest state.
